일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| 6 | 7 |
8 | 9 | 10 | 11 | 12 | 13 | 14 |
15 | 16 | 17 | 18 | 19 | 20 | 21 |
22 | 23 | 24 | 25 | 26 | 27 | 28 |
29 | 30 | 31 |
- darkest dark
- 데이터길이
- 알고리즘
- 2156
- Database
- 자바
- ANSI JOIN
- 소숫점처리
- 백준
- Eclipse
- 입출력
- Algorithm
- Dynamic Programming
- 10951
- 동적계획법
- algoritm
- n x 2 타일링 2
- 오라클
- select
- Java
- 데이터베이스
- 변수
- DP
- db
- 그대로 출력하기
- 문자열
- 반복문
- oracle
- JOIN
- SQL
- Today
- Total
목록전체 글 (78)
Cracking Code
SQL 문장 내의 숫자 및 날짜 타입은 +, -, *, / 연산이 가능합니다. SCOTT 계정으로 접속하여 EMP 테이블의 SAL을 출력합니다. 여기서 SAL 컬럼에 각종 연산을 적용하여 여러 개 출력하겠습니다. SELECT SAL, SAL + 100, SAL - 100, SAL * 1.1, SAL / 2 FROM EMP; 테이블 내의 데이터 값은 변경 되지 않고 출력만 해줍니다.
SELECT 문은 SQL의 DQL(Data Query Language) 질의어에 해당합니다. DB의 데이터를 조회할 때 사용합니다. SELECT 문의 기본적인 문법 SELECT [DISTINCT] { *, column [alias], ... } FROM table; -- DISTINCT 는 생략 가능 저번 시간에 사용했던 SCOTT 계정의 예제 테이블을 이용하여 실습하도록 합니다. SCOTT 계정의 테이블 목록이 무엇이 있는지 확인 합니다. SELECT * FROM TAB; -- *은 모든 것을 뜻함 BONUS, DEPT, EMP, SALGRADE 테이블이 출력되었습니다. 테이블의 데이터를 조회하도록 하겠습니다. EMP 테이블의 데이터를 출력합니다. SELECT * FROM EMP; EMP 테이블의 모든..
이번에는 DBMS 실습을 위한 SQL Developer를 설치하고 실행해보겠습니다. https://www.oracle.com/tools/downloads/sqldev-downloads.html SQL Developer 는 GUI 기반으로 유저에게 좀 더 쉽게 Database에 접근할 수 있도록 도와줍니다. 설치 방법 위의 링크로 들어가 자신의 운영체제와 환경에 맞는 다운로드 링크를 통해 다운받습니다. Windows의 경우 압축을 해제해주시면 설치가 완료됩니다. 압축 해제 후 실행해볼까요? 처음 화면이 정상적으로 출력되었습니다! 데이터베이스에 접속해보도록 하겠습니다. 기본 화면에서 왼쪽위의 초록색 + 버튼을 클릭합니다. 위의 화면에서 접속에 필요한 세팅을 하여 접속, 테스트, 저장 등을 할 수 있습니다. ..
이번 게시글에선 Oracle 11g 설치 및 환경 구성을 해도록 하겠습니다. Oracle 11g 을 설치하여 학습하기에 게시글은 Oracle 11g 기반으로 작성합니다! https://www.oracle.com/kr/database/technologies/oracle-database-software-downloads.html Oracle 11g 를 자신의 운영체제에 맞게 다운로드를 받습니다. 주의!) File 1, 2 둘 다 받아서 한 폴더에 압축을 풀어주셔야 합니다. 압축을 풀고 setup.exe 를 실행하면 아래와 같은 설치 화면이 보여지게 됩니다. 우리는 학습용으로 사용하기에 전자 메일은 아무렇게나! My Oracle Support를 통해 보안 갱신 수신 체크 해제! 하고 나서 다음을 클릭하시면 접..
자바를 사용하여 개발하기 위해선 JDK가 필요합니다. 추후에 사용할 Spring 등 호환성을 위해 jdk 버전은 8버전을 사용하도록 하겠습니다. 또한 곧 사용할 SQL Developer 를 실행하게 할 수 있습니다. https://www.oracle.com/kr/java/technologies/javase/javase-jdk8-downloads.html 운영체제에 맞는 인스톨러를 다운 받아서 설치합니다. 처음부터 끝까지 Next 버튼을 클릭합니다. jre 설치도 전부 다음을 클릭해줍니다. 설치가 완료 되면 Close를 누르고 환경변수를 설정합니다. 내 PC - 속성 - 고급 시스템 설정 오른쪽 아래 환경 변수를 클릭합니다. 새로 만들기 변수 이름: JAVA_HOME 변수 값: jdk가 설치된 폴더 경로 ..
Database DBMS에 의해 관리되는 데이터의 집합 DBMS(Oracle, MySQL 등) 컴퓨터에 저장된 대량의 데이터를 체계적으로 관리하고 사용자가 원하는 정보를 효과적으로 검색하기 위한 소프트웨어 데이터의 구조 데이터는 2차원 구조로 되어있으며 아래와 같습니다. SQL(Structured Query Language) 사용자와 관계형 데이터베이스를 연결해주는 표준 검색 언어 SQL은 기본적으로 대소문자 구분을 하지 않으며 반드시 세미콜론 ; 으로 끝납니다 그래도 대문자로 사용하는 것을 권장한다고 합니다! SQL 문장의 종류 DQL(Data Query Language) 질의어 select 검색 DML(Data Manipulation Language) 데이터 조작어 insert 입력 update 수정..